Output e14f40c23250d6403256451e6c95a96887306fa909c559fd82d10eff38769512:4

value
72929273
script pubkey
OP_0 OP_PUSHBYTES_20 5b949f8b3087f37bd4ffcc1993384b06ea3cd940
address
bc1qtw2flzesslehh48lesvexwztqm4rek2qh3qrjj
transaction
e14f40c23250d6403256451e6c95a96887306fa909c559fd82d10eff38769512
confirmations
271728
spent
true